CBSE Class 12 Mathematics Syllabus 2023-24: The Central Board of Secondary Education has released the CBSE Class 12 Mathematics Syllabus (subject code 041) for the academic year 2023-2024. The syllabus comprises six units, and the theory examination will be out of 80 marks. Unlike traditional chapter-wise mark allocation, the syllabus emphasises the competencies assessed by the questions. CBSE Class 12 Maths Syllabus 2024 Topics Covered
Unit-I: Relations and Functions
The topics covered in Unit 1 are discussed below:
-
Relations and Functions: ypes of relations: reflexive, symmetric, transitive and equivalence relations. One to one and onto functions.
-
Inverse Trigonometric Functions: Definition, range, domain, principal value branch. Graphs of inverse trigonometric functions.
Unit-II: Algebra
The topics covered in Unit 2 are discussed below:
Matrices Concept, notation, order, equality, types of matrices, zero and identity matrix, transpose of a matrix, symmetric and skew-symmetric matrices. Operations on matrices: Addition and multiplication and multiplication with a scalar. Simple properties of addition, multiplication and scalar multiplication. Noncommutativity of multiplication of matrices and existence of non-zero matrices whose product is the zero matrix (restricted to square matrices of order
2). Invertible matrices and proof of the uniqueness of inverse, if it exists; (Here, all matrices will have accurate entries).
2. Determinants:
-
Determinant of a square matrix
-
Minors, co-factors and applications of determinants in finding the area of a triangle.
-
Adjoint and inverse of a square matrix.
-
Consistency, inconsistency and number of solutions of a system of linear equations by examples, solving a system of linear equations in two or three variables (having unique solution) using the inverse of a matrix.
Unit-III: Calculus
The topics covered in Unit 3 are discussed below:
1. Continuity and Differentiability
-
Continuity and differentiability,
-
chain rule,
-
derivative of inverse trigonometric functions,
-
Concept of exponential and logarithmic functions.
-
Derivatives of logarithmic and exponential functions.
-
Logarithmic differentiation,
-
Derivative of functions expressed in parametric forms.
-
Second order derivatives.
2. Applications of Derivatives:
-
Rate of change of quantities,
-
Increasing/decreasing functions,
-
Maxima and minima (first derivative test motivated geometrically and second derivative test given as a provable tool).
-
Simple problems (that illustrate basic principles and understanding of the subject as well as reallife situations).
3. Integrals
-
Integration as inverse process of differentiation.
-
Integration of a variety of functions by substitution, by partial fractions and by parts,
-
Evaluation of simple integrals of the following types and problems based on them. Fundamental Theorem of Calculus (without proof).
-
Basic properties of definite integrals and evaluation of definite integrals.
4. Applications of the Integrals
Applications in finding the area under simple curves, especially lines, circles/ parabolas/ellipses (in standard form only)
5. Differential Equations
-
Definition of differential equations,
-
Order and degree of differential equations,
-
General and particular solutions of a differential equation.
-
Solution of differential equations by method of separation of variables,
-
Solutions of homogeneous differential equations of first order and first degree.
-
Solutions of linear differential equation of the type: dy dx + py = q,
Unit-IV: Vectors and Three-Dimensional Geometry
The topics covered in Unit 4 are discussed below:
1. Vectors:
-
Vectors and scalars,
-
Magnitude and direction of a vector.
-
Direction cosines and direction ratios of a vector.
-
Types of vectors
-
Position vector of a point, negative of a vector,
-
components of a vector,
-
Addition of vectors,
-
Multiplication of a vector by a scalar,
-
Position vector of a point dividing a line segment in a given ratio.
-
Properties and application of scalar (dot) product of vectors, vector (cross) product of vectors.
2. Three - dimensional Geometry
-
Direction cosines and direction ratios of a line joining two points.
-
Cartesian equation and vector equation of a line,
-
Skew lines, shortest distance between two lines.
-
Angle between two lines.
Unit-V: Linear Programming
The topics covered in Unit 5 are discussed below:
-
Introduction to Linera Programming
-
Related terminology such as constraints,
-
Objective function,
-
Optimisation,
-
Graphical method of solution for problems in two variables,
-
Feasible and infeasible regions (bounded or unbounded),
-
Feasible and infeasible solutions,
-
Optimal feasible solutions (up to three non-trivial constraints).
Unit-VI: Probability
The topics covered in Unit 6 are discussed below:
-
Conditional probability,
-
Multiplication theorem on probability,
-
Independent events,
-
Total probability,
-
Bayes’ theorem,
-
Random variable and its probability distribution,
-
Mean of a random variable.

There is no specific weightage assigned to individual chapters. It's important to ensure that all chapters are covered.
-
To create different question templates, you can make appropriate internal adjustments while maintaining a consistent overall distribution of question types and their weighting.
Choices
There will be no overall choice in the question paper. However, 33% of internal choices will be given in all the sections.
CBSE Class 12 Maths Syllabus 2023-24 For Internal Assessment
CBSE Class 12 Math syllabus 2023-24 includes internal assessment worth 20 marks. This assessment has two parts: Periodic Tests and Mathematics Activities. The Periodic Test is a written test worth 10 marks, and it includes different types of questions like very short answers, short answers, and long answer questions to evaluate your knowledge, understanding, application, skills, and analysis. For the Mathematics Activities part, you can refer to the NCERT Lab Manual, and it's also worth 10 marks.
